Chromatography is a laboratory technique used to separate mixtures into their individual components.
Chromatography involves a stationary phase and a mobile phase
The components of the mixture interact differently with the stationary phase, leading to separation
Common types include gas chromatography, liquid chromatography, and thin-layer chromatography
Depth filtration is a filtration method where particles are captured within the thickness of the filter medium.
Depth filtration involves particles being trapped within the filter matrix rather than just on the surface.
It is commonly used in industries such as pharmaceuticals, food and beverage, and water treatment.
Examples of depth filtration media include sand filters, activated carbon filters, and diatomaceous earth

UV-Vis spectroscopy is a technique that measures the absorption of ultraviolet and visible light by a sample.
UV-Vis spectroscopy is used to determine the concentration of a sample, as well as its purity and identity.
It works by passing light through a sample and measuring the amount of light absorbed at different wavelengths.

pH range for solutions is a measure of acidity or alkalinity on a scale of 0-14.
A pH of 7 is neutral, below 7 is acidic, and above 7 is alkaline.
Acidic solutions have a pH below 7, such as lemon juice (pH 2) or vinegar (pH 3).
Alkaline solutions have a pH above 7, such as baking soda (pH 9) or bleach (pH 12).
The pH range is important in many fields, including chemistry, biology, and environmental science.
KF autotitrator is an instrument used for determining water content in a sample by titration with Karl Fischer reagent.
KF autotitrator uses Karl Fischer reagent to determine water content in a sample
It is an automated titration instrument
The principle behind KF autotitrator is based on the reaction between iodine and sulfur dioxide in the presence of water

Volumetric solutions are prepared by accurately measuring the volume of a solute and dissolving it in a solvent to a known volume.
Volumetric solutions are used in analytical chemistry for titrations and other quantitative analyses.
The solute is usually a solid or liquid that is weighed on a balance before being added to the solvent.

Potentiometry is a method of measuring the potential difference between two electrodes in a solution to determine the concentration of an ion.
Potentiometry is based on the principle that the potential difference between two electrodes in a solution is proportional to the concentration of an ion.
It is commonly used in analytical chemistry to measure the concentration of ions in a solution.

Volumetric titrations are of different types based on the nature of the reaction involved.
Acid-base titration
Redox titration
Complexometric titration
Precipitation titration
Non-aqueous titration

Track and trace is a system used to monitor and trace the movement of goods or products throughout the supply chain.
Track and trace involves assigning unique identifiers to products or packages to track their location and movement.
It helps in ensuring product authenticity, preventing counterfeiting, and improving supply chain visibility.
